Founded in 2021 out of MIT CSAIL's Improbably AI Lab, Tutor Intelligence is a robotics research and deployment company building generally capable robots for the common good, in partnership with the people who need them. Driving the development of industrially-viable physical AI through a real-world data collection and deployment flywheel, Tutor powers both in-house model development and national supply chain operations in one motion.
Tutor's robot workers, Cassie and Sonny, run in production environments across North America on a mixed autonomy platform: foundation models drive the work, and human intelligence from all over the world is pointed at the slices that exceed autonomous capability. Every minute of that work creates both economic value and the on-distribution data set that drives research, builds leverage, and brings new capabilities to life.
